A "Cargo Milestone" represents a definitive, verifiable status update during the transit of goods. For multi-national retailers, these milestones are the heartbeat of their logistical operations. They include events such as "Container Gate-in at Origin," "Vessel Departure," "Transshipment Port Arrival," "Customs Release," and "Cargo Discharged at Destination." Historically, retailers relied on manual EDI status updates or emails from freight forwarders, which were often delayed by 24 to 48 hours. In today's fast-paced market, where consumer demand shifts rapidly and supply chains must remain agile, real-time data integration via open APIs has become the standard for industry leaders.
By leveraging advanced APIs, retailers can aggregate multi-carrier tracking data into a single, unified dashboard. This centralized view allows supply chain managers to monitor the exact progress of every container, identify potential bottlenecks before they escalate, and make data-driven decisions to reroute shipments or adjust store inventory levels dynamically. When logistics teams know precisely when a shipment has cleared customs or when it is scheduled to arrive at the distribution center, they can optimize labor scheduling, plan warehouse capacity, and ensure that promotional campaigns align perfectly with product arrivals.

For multi-national retailers, the cost of cargo pick-up failure at the destination port goes beyond simple financial penalties. When seasonal merchandise, high-demand consumer electronics, or perishable goods sit idle at a congested port, the retail brand suffers. Store shelves remain empty, online orders face delays, and customer trust is eroded. By analyzing historical milestone data, retailers can identify which ports, carriers, or local customs offices present the highest risk of delay. This intelligence empowers procurement and logistics teams to negotiate better contracts, optimize routing strategies, and build more resilient supply chains.
Furthermore, the integration of AI and predictive analytics is transforming how retailers utilize cargo milestones. Instead of merely reacting to events that have already occurred, modern tracking platforms use machine learning algorithms to predict future milestones. By analyzing historical transit times, weather patterns, port congestion indexes, and carrier performance, these systems can forecast potential delays days or weeks in advance. For example, if an AI model predicts a high probability of cargo pick-up failure at a specific terminal due to upcoming labor shortages, the retailer can proactively arrange alternative drayage services or divert the shipment to an adjacent port, ensuring uninterrupted supply chain flow.
